England completed an easy win against Ireland in the end in the one-off ODI at Dublin, despite having some problems early in their chase of 270.

Ireland captain William Porterfield scored a century (112), while England's Boyd Rankin impressed with a four-wicket haul, giving away 46 runs in his nine overs.

For England, both captain Eoin Morgan (124 not out) and Ravi Bopara (101 not out) scored centuries to finish a steady chase after being at 48/4 at one stage.

For Ireland, Tim Murtagh took three wickets, and bowled two maidens in his ten overs, giving away 33 runs.
